On a collective scale, the two world wars and the wars of decolonization have left behind generations marked by the experience of disrupted bonds with parents. On a private level, recent years have seen a growing awareness of the presence of violence even in the family sphere. It is precisely at the point where violence and filiation collide that this symposium intends to focus. We propose to examine the impact of private and public violence on questions of filiation in the twentieth and twenty-first centuries.
